By Rose Gruenbacher

A small committee will form this week to address road closures in Aggieville after several concerned Aggieville business owners spoke up during the monthly meeting of the Riley County Law Enforcement Agency Board on Monday.

They expressed continued concerns about the perception the district gets from streets into the area being shut down on Friday and Saturday nights, and the decline in business they say it’s caused.

Executive director of the Aggieville Business Association, Dennis Cook, told the board that through his seven years as director, he’s pushed for increased safety and security in the area.
